    Man City eye winter swoop for PSG star Bradley Barcola

    Manchester City could reignite their interest in Bradley Barcola this winter, with Pep Guardiola still keen on bringing the Paris Saint-Germain star to the Etihad. Reports from Fichajes suggest that City remain firmly in the mix and may explore a January approach after initially targeting the French winger in the summer.

    Back in August, Guardiola wanted fresh firepower out wide, but complications around a deal for Barcola meant progress stalled. City were linked with a host of wide forwards, including Real Madrid’s Rodrygo and their own rising star Savinho, who drew strong interest from Tottenham. Ultimately, Guardiola opted to keep Savinho, but Spurs are tipped to return with a bid in January – potentially reopening the door for City to chase Barcola.

    Rodrygo Off the Table, Barcola Back in Focus

    While Rodrygo was heavily courted in the summer by Arsenal, Liverpool, and City, the Brazilian decided to stay put in Madrid. With that move looking unlikely before next summer, Guardiola could pivot his focus back to Barcola, a player he sees as a perfect fit for City’s attacking system.

    The 23-year-old France international offers pace, flair, and versatility – qualities that would enhance Guardiola’s tactical options. However, landing him won’t be straightforward. PSG made it clear during the last window that Barcola was not for sale, and with no financial pressure to sell, their stance may remain unchanged in January.

    Tough Deal, But Not Impossible

    Manchester City certainly have the resources to test PSG’s resolve, but whether the French champions entertain offers in mid-season is another question. While a winter swoop looks complicated, Guardiola could play the long game, lining up a more realistic move for Barcola next summer.

    For now, City fans can expect plenty of transfer chatter – but whether Barcola trades Paris for Manchester in January remains a big doubt.

  • Liverpool ready to sign PSG star Bradley Barcola

    According to L’Equipe, LIVERPOOL are ready to reignite their interest in Bradley Barcola, who is a long-term target, as they continue to face difficulties in their pursuit of Alexander Isak.

    Liverpool have already spent almost £300 million ($400m) this summer, as they have signed Florian Wirtz, Hugo Ekitike, Milos Kerkez and Jeremie Frimpong, but it has been widely speculated that Isak is a player the club would like to acquire.

    Isak had his best season in the Premier League last year and netted an impressive 23 goals for the Toon, but he has been all over the headlines over the past week after it emerged that he has asked to leave Newcastle.

    That prompted Liverpool to make their move to try and get a deal done, with many reports in the media claiming that the Reds had submitted an offer of £110 million to try and get Newcastle to offload their star man, but their bid for the Newcastle star has been rejected.

    And with the Toon reportedly keen to not lower their asking price, both the PSG star and Real Madrid’s Rodrygo are seen as potential alternatives.

    A deal to land Barcola would reportedly cost around €100m (£133.5m) in addition to what has already gone out of the Reds’ account, but the Anfield club is supposedly ready to make a bid
